Engine Air Cleaner/Filter
ªVORTECº 2200 L4 Engine
ªVORTECº 4300 V6 Engine
See ªEngine Compartment Overviewº in the Index for
more information on location.
To remove either engine air cleaner/filter, do the following:
1. Remove the fasteners that hold the cover on.
2. Remove the cover and lift out the engine air cleaner/filter.
3. Insert a new air filter.
4. Reinstall the engine air cleaner/filter cover.
Tighten the fasteners to hold the cover in place.
Page 284 of 407

6-19
Refer to the Maintenance Schedule to determine when
to replace the engine air cleaner/filter. See ªScheduled
Maintenance Servicesº in the Index.
CAUTION:
Operating the engine with the air cleaner/filter
off can cause you or others to be burned. The air
cleaner not only cleans the air, it stops flame if
the engine backfires. If it isn't there, and the
engine backfires, you could be burned. Don't
drive with it off, and be careful working on the
engine with the air cleaner/filter off.
NOTICE:
If the air cleaner/filter is off, a backfire can
cause a damaging engine fire. And, dirt can easily
get into your engine, which will damage it.
Always have the air cleaner/filter in place when
you're driving.
Automatic Transmission Fluid
When to Check and Change
A good time to check your automatic transmission fluid
level is when the engine oil is changed.
Change both the fluid and filter every 15,000 miles
(25 000 km) if the vehicle is mainly driven under one or
more of these conditions:
In heavy city traffic where the outside temperature
regularly reaches 90F (32C) or higher.
In hilly or mountainous terrain.
When doing frequent trailer towing.
Uses such as found in taxi, police or delivery service.
If you do not use your vehicle under any of
these conditions, change the fluid and filter
every 50,000 miles (83 000 km).
See ªScheduled Maintenance Servicesº in the Index.

Capacities and Specifications
Please refer to ªRecommended Fluids and Lubricantsº
in the index for more information. See refrigerant
change label under the hood for charge capacity
information and requirements.
Wheel Nut Torque100 lb
-ft (140 N´m) . . . . . . . . . .
Tire PressureSee the Certification/Tire . . . . . . . . . . .
label. See ªLoading Your Vehicleº in the Index.
Cooling System*
2.2L Engine 9.9 quarts (9.4 L). .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. .
4.3L Engine w/Auto. Trans. 13.8 quarts (13.1 L). . . .
4.3L Engine w/Manual. Trans. 14.1 quarts (13.3 L). .
Engine Crankcase
- Oil and Filter Change*
2.2L Engine 4.5 quarts (4.3 L). .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. .
4.3L Engine 4.5 quarts (4.3 L). .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. Fuel Capacity
Reg./Ext. Cab 18.5 U.S. Gallons (70.0 L). . . . . . . . . .
Crew Cab 19.0 U.S. Gallons (71.9 L). . . . . . . . . . . . .
Automatic Transmission*
Drain and Refill 5.0 quarts (4.7 L). . . . . . . . . . . . . . .
Differential Fluid
Rear Axle 4.0 pints (1.9 L). .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. .
Front Axle 2.6 pints (1.2 L). .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. .
Refrigerant, Air ConditioningSee Refrigerant . . .
Label under the hood.
*After refill, the level must be checked.
All capacities are approximate. When adding, be sure to
fill to the appropriate level or as recommended in this
manual. See ªRecommended Fluids and Lubricantsº in
the Index.

Normal Maintenance Replacement Parts
Replacement part numbers listed in this section are based on the latest information available at the time of printing
and are subject to change. If a part listed in this manual is not the same as the part used in your vehicle when it was
built, or if you have any questions, please contact your GM dealer.
Engine ªVORTECº 2200 L4 ªVORTECº 4300 V6
Oil Filter PF47 PF47
Air Cleaner Filter A1163C A1163C
PCV Valve N/A CV769C
Automatic Transmission Filter Kit 24200796 24200796
Spark Plugs
41
-948 41-932
Fuel Filter GF481 GF481
Windshield Wiper Blades Trico (20 inches/51 cm) Trico (20 inches/51 cm)
